Q: Is 392,464 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 392,464 is not a prime number.

Why is 392,464 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 392464 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 16 19 38 76 152 304 1,291 2,582 5,164 10,328 20,656 24,529 49,058 98,116 196,232 and 392,464, with no remainder.

Since 392,464 cannot be divided by just 1 and 392,464, it is not a prime number.
